The Hydrometeorological Institute has issued an updated weather forecast indicating the development of convective clouds across several regions of the country. These cloud formations are generating conditions conducive to localized rainfall. Associated weather hazards include intermittent lightning, strong wind gusts, and, in isolated locations, the possibility of hail.
According to the IHK, the rainfall is not expected to affect the entirety of Kosovo. The current meteorological conditions involve convective clouds developing across multiple areas, leading to the described localized weather patterns. These conditions are accompanied by high temperatures, with the current temperature reported near 32°C.
The updated forecast advises the public to be aware of the potential for sudden weather changes due to these convective clouds. While the rainfall is localized, the combination of strong winds and lightning necessitates caution, particularly in areas where hail may occur. The IHK continues to monitor the atmospheric conditions to provide further updates as necessary, advising residents to take appropriate precautions against the developing weather system.
